Competitive Context
No direct competitor has a published Partner API Key program at the agent orchestration layer. This is a first-mover opportunity. The battlecard row frames mol_pk_* as a structural differentiator — not a feature checkbox.

Positioning Claims
Lead claim: ✅ VERIFIED (Research team audit, 2026-04-23) — "Molecule AI is the first agent platform with a first-class partner provisioning API — letting marketplaces, CI/CD pipelines, and automation platforms create and manage Molecule AI orgs via API, without a browser session."
Rationale: Competitive Intel audited LangGraph Cloud, CrewAI, Azure AI Foundry, Dify, Flowise, and n8n. None have a documented programmatic partner org provisioning API equivalent to
mol_pk_*. Use "first-mover" framing (not "only") for legal defensibility — a competitor could launch tomorrow.
Supporting claims:
- Org-scoped by design —
mol_pk_*keys cannot escape their org boundary. Compromised keys neutralize with one API call. - CI/CD-native — ephemeral test orgs per PR. No shared state. No manual cleanup.
- Platform-first — LangGraph charges per seat. CrewAI offers marketplace listing. Molecule AI offers an API to build either.
Risks to monitor:
- AWS/GCP/Azure publish their own partner/OEM programs → Phase 34 becomes table stakes faster
- CrewAI ships partner API → first-mover window closes; update claim to "pioneered" framing
